Understanding Tesla Taillight Assembly Issues
Tesla taillight assembly issues can arise due to a variety of reasons, from minor damage to more complex electrical problems. If your Tesla’s taillights are flickering, not illuminating properly, or even completely non-functional, it could be indicative of a faulty assembly. These issues might not always be immediately apparent, but they can escalate if left unattended. Regular inspections and prompt repairs, especially after minor collisions or bumps, are crucial in preventing more extensive car body repair work down the line.
In many cases, troubleshooting these problems may require reinitialization of the vehicle’s software, which controls various functions including lighting systems. Software Reinitialization: The Fix Process
Software reinitialization is a critical step in the Tesla taillight assembly repair process. Often, issues with the taillights stem from glitches in the vehicle’s software system, which controls their functionality. During this fix, specialized technicians access and reset the software, ensuring it communicates effectively with the car’s electrical components. This involves advanced diagnostic tools to identify and rectify any errors, bringing the taillights back to full operation.

Preventive Measures for Future Repairs
To prevent future issues with Tesla taillight assembly repair, regular maintenance is key. Checking the lights for any signs of damage or wear and replacing them promptly can save you from more complex repairs down the line. Additionally, keeping your vehicle’s software up-to-date through official over-the-air updates ensures optimal performance and functionality of all systems, including lighting.
Regular inspection of your car’s exterior, specifically focusing on the taillights, is an important part of automotive restoration. If you notice any cracks or damages to the assembly, address them immediately.
